Mithradates III, 39/40-44/5.
Stater 39-40 (year 336), AV 7.86 g. Head of Gaius r. Rev. BACIΛE ΩC MIΘPI ΔATOV• Nike advancing l., holding wreath and palm frond; in field, ς ΛΤ (date). Frolova dies A-a. MacDonald 308. Jameson 2148 (this coin). Anokhin 327. RPC 1908.
Extremely rare, by far the finest of only five specimens known. A very interesting
portrait struck on a large flan, a minor edge mark at nine o'clock on reverse,
otherwise extremely fine / good extremely fine

Ex Hess-Leu sale 16 April 1957, Hirsch, 250. From the Jameson, Grand Duke Alexander Mikhailovich collections and a Distinguished Swiss Collection.
